WATCH: Michelle Obama Speaks Up About Marriage Equality

So, what does First Lady Michelle Obama think about same-sex marriage? Considering Vice-President Joe Biden and her own husband have voiced full-fledged support for marriage equality, it’s not surprising that Michelle does also. Still, it’s beyond wonderful to hear her vocalize it nationally.

In a video released yesterday where the First Lady answers questions from her Twitter (@MichelleObama), she responded to one citizen’s request, “Please tell us about your family discussions about marriage equality and thank President Obama for his support!”

Michelle responses at the 5:20 mark:

“It really comes down to the values of fairness and equality that we want to pass down to our girls. I mean, these are basic values that kids learn at a very young age and that we encourage them to apply in all areas of their lives. And in a country where we teach our children that everyone is equal under the law, discriminating against same-sex couples just isn’t right.”
